A massive landslide was caught on camera as it made its way down the mountain. There has been a few problems in the area where small amounts of debris and rocks would come tumbling down. However, this time, it was much larger and much more ferocious.

Londa Edwards posted the video that shows a landslide that started off small and then became too big to handle. Her husband, Bret Edwards was on site working his usual day to day job when he noticed something was on the way.
Bret usually takes his mobile device out to film the smaller landslides that happen, however, this time he struck gold.
The landslide took place at Highway 14 near Elk City, Idaho when the quiet situation turned into a very serious and dangerous ordeal. All of a sudden, a few small rocks began to fall and then some other larger ones came tumbling down, taking with it huge trees.
